        Re: Honda CB Hornet 160R launched at Rs 79900/-

        Originally posted by saran93 View Post
        Combined brake system means.. Equal pressure on both brakes.. During braking?
        no, depending on the class of bike (or scooter) the pressure distribution varies. but a component of the pressure is also directed at the forward brake.
        this is achieved by the centre piston on the front brake. (there are 3)

              Originally posted by ani2607 View Post


              can we rather say that CBS is sort of a cheaper substitute for ABS?
              cause primarily ABS prevents skidding and well due to CBS there wont be too much braking pressure on just one tire thereby preventing unnecessary skids.
              you could say that. it is NOT ABS, it does not avoid a wheel lock, but it does reduce the possibility of wheel lock by ensuring both wheels brakes contribute to speed reduction even with application of only 1 brake...
